The origins of a misunderstood ingredient
MSG is simply the sodium salt of glutamic acid, an amino acid that occurs naturally in numerous foods we consume daily. According researchers MSG was first extracted from seaweed broth in 1908 and subsequently adopted worldwide as a flavor enhancer.
This crystalline powder gained popularity for its ability to enhance the savory umami flavor profile in foods. Despite its long history in global cuisine, MSG became controversial in Western countries following reports of adverse reactions, leading to widespread avoidance and negative perceptions that persist today.
The disconnect between MSG’s scientific profile and public perception represents a peculiar case where cultural attitudes have overshadowed evidence-based understanding. This gap has led to significant confusion among consumers trying to make informed dietary choices.
Scientific consensus challenges popular beliefs
Despite its reputation for causing headaches, nausea, and other symptoms, the U.S. Food and Drug Administration has designated MSG as generally recognized as safe for consumption. This classification comes after decades of research examining its effects on human health.
Nutritionists point out a fact that may surprise many consumers: MSG actually contains less sodium than regular table salt. This characteristic makes it potentially useful for individuals seeking to reduce their sodium intake while maintaining flavor in foods.
The controversy surrounding MSG often overlooks this crucial distinction. Many processed foods containing MSG are unhealthy not because of the MSG itself, but due to high levels of unhealthy fats, sugars, and other additives. The association between MSG and these unhealthy foods has contributed significantly to its negative reputation.
Understanding sensitivity reactions
Despite the scientific consensus on MSG safety, some individuals report experiencing sensitivity reactions after consuming foods containing the additive. These symptoms can include flushing, tingling sensations, headaches, and nausea, particularly after consuming large amounts.
Doctors identify these reactions as part of what has been termed MSG Complex Syndrome. While these reactions are real for affected individuals, they typically occur in response to unusually high concentrations of MSG rather than the moderate amounts found in most foods.
Research indicates that true MSG sensitivity affects a small percentage of the population. For the vast majority of consumers, MSG consumption within normal dietary patterns poses no significant health risks according to current scientific understanding.
The evolution of MSG research
Early research on MSG produced concerning results that contributed to its negative reputation. Some studies suggested potential toxicity and harmful effects on brain health. However, nutritional scientists now recognize significant methodological flaws in these early investigations.
Many problematic studies used extremely high doses of MSG administered through injection rather than oral consumption, creating conditions that do not reflect typical dietary exposure. When consumed orally in normal amounts, approximately 0.5 grams per serving, research indicates MSG does not present the same risks.
More recent and methodologically sound research has yielded different conclusions. One notable study found that individuals who consumed soup containing MSG actually ate less than those who did not, suggesting potential benefits for appetite regulation rather than adverse effects.
Major health organizations worldwide, including the World Health Organization and European Food Safety Authority, have reviewed the available evidence and deemed MSG safe for consumption within recommended limits. This scientific consensus stands in contrast to persistent public concerns.
Where MSG appears in our food supply
MSG appears in a wide range of foods, both as a naturally occurring compound and as an added ingredient. Consumers frequently encounter MSG in:
- Asian cuisine where it has been traditionally used as a flavor enhancer
- Processed foods including many convenience meals and snack products
- Canned goods particularly vegetables and prepared soups
- Deli meats where it enhances flavor and extends shelf life
- Condiments and seasonings from salad dressings to flavor packets
Additionally, MSG occurs naturally in foods many consider healthy and desirable. Mushrooms, aged cheeses, tomatoes, and garlic all contain natural glutamates that provide the same umami flavor profile as added MSG.
Regulatory requirements mandate that MSG be listed on food labels when added to products. This transparency allows consumers to make informed choices about their MSG consumption based on personal preferences.
Guidelines for consumption
For those without specific sensitivity to MSG, health authorities provide reassuring guidance on consumption limits. The World Health Organization recommends a maximum intake of 120 milligrams per kilogram of body weight daily.
The European Food Safety Authority suggests a slightly more conservative limit of 14 milligrams per pound of body weight daily. For a person weighing 150 pounds, this translates to approximately 2.1 grams of MSG per day, an amount significantly higher than most people would consume through normal dietary patterns.
Nutritionists suggest that MSG itself can be part of a healthy diet, but advises caution regarding packaged foods containing the additive. These products often contain other less desirable ingredients that may impact overall nutritional quality.
For those seeking to maximize dietary quality while enjoying flavorful foods, understanding the context of MSG becomes important. The additive itself is not inherently problematic, but its presence often signals highly processed foods that nutrition experts recommend limiting for other reasons.
